Inventory of county records, Throckmorton County courthouse, Throckmorton, Texas

Inventory of county records, Throckmorton County courthouse, Throckmorton, Texas
Description:

Inventory of records of Throckmorton County housed in the Throckmorton County courthouse in Throckmorton. Begins with an introduction and explanation of the roles of various county government offices. Describes the records of the County Clerk: As Secretary for Commissioners Court, County Clerk: As Recorder, County Clerk: As Reporter for County Court, District Clerk, Tax Assessor-Collector, Justice of the Peace, Sheriff, County Judge, and County Treasurer. Also provides a list of Tarrant County records and an index.

The Texas County Records Inventory Project, headquartered at North Texas State University, Denton, is a county-by-county survey of all records germane to the operation of county government located in county courthouses and other storage facilities.
